Release checklist — Bouncewright v2.6: before flipping traffic, confirm the bounce processor drains the retry queue cleanly on staging and that hard-bounce suppression writes land in under a second. Ping Odile if the DLQ isn't empty. Once you've verified, stamp the deploy record with the build token shown below.

session token of tajef-bageg = htk21_5d90d574934f3ccae6437

### Step 3 — Migrate TideMark widget data

The TideMark widget previously cached tide tables in browser storage; predictions now come from the central Brindlehook service. For review purposes: the widget has read-only access, queries are parameterized, and credentials rotate quarterly. Export legacy cache entries, verify checksums, then load them into the new store. The store is reached via the following.

replica DSN, yahog-kawig: redis://istox_svc:um@db-8a67.halixforge.test:5432/frawyn

Handover: Tilecache Prefetcher

From Marek to Ines, for the security review. The prefetcher pulls map tiles ahead of user pans; it runs with a scoped fetch token and no write access. Rate limits were tightened last sprint. Nothing stores user location. The reviewer should verify the settings currently deployed, listed here.

deployment values, bahof-kafog:
FENAEL_LOG_LEVEL=warn
FENAEL_METRICS_HOST=metrics.fenael.qorvellabs.corp
FENAEL_POOL_SIZE=16

Memo — Tarnbeck Supply Renewal

Sales leads: the Tarnbeck Materials contract renews 1 April. New terms raise unit costs 5% but guarantee allocation through peak season, which protects delivery promises on the Coppervale accounts. Quote lead times unchanged; do not adjust pricing until finance issues the updated sheet. Escalate any at-risk commitments to Ingrid this week. The renewal's bearing on next year's plan is noted below.

board note of bawep-tajef: Queniusek Systems plans to raise the Quenvan list price by 53.1 percent in March. The pricing group signed off on a budget of $176.4 million for Project Drueth. The renewal with Casionix Partners closes at $142.5 million a year, 8.3 percent below the last contract. Project Fraax slips by six weeks because of the tooling delay.